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Moorthorpe to Hanborough start from as little as £40.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Moorthorpe to Hanborough are available for £126.60 one way, or £253.00 return

Station Details and Facilities

Moorthorpe station, operated by Northern, may not boast the vast array of amenities like larger stations, but it manages to cater effectively to the needs of its passengers. Though it lacks a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available, ensuring effortless ticket collection for journeys purchased online. It's a station that's about straightforward, accessible travel—no frills needed.

Accessibility is partially provided, with step-free access available on parts of the station. Travelers heading to York can enjoy level access to their platform, while those destined for Sheffield can utilize the ramped access. Despite being unstaffed, there's always an option to call the helpline for assistance, making travel as stress-free as possible.

While you won't find waiting rooms, refreshments, or shopping facilities here, Moorthorpe does prioritize safety and basic conveniences with features like basic CCTV coverage and an induction loop for hearing assistance. Bicycle storage is available, offering 10 sheltered spaces on Platform 2, making it a sensible choice for eco-conscious travelers looking to reduce their carbon footprint.

Transport Links and Connectivity

Moorthorpe provides easy access to several transport services making onward travel seamless. While the station doesn't play host to a bustling taxi rank on site, visitors can utilize the Cab4You service for reliable taxi connections. Bus services are close by, ensuring that passengers can connect to local amenities and neighboring towns without hassle. For those requiring rail replacement services, the pickup and drop-off points are conveniently located on the main road, Barnsley Rd.

Station Amenities and Facilities

At Hanborough station, convenience is a priority. While there is no staffed ticket office, ticket machines are available to ensure smooth transactions for all passenger needs. These machines are accessible, allowing for easy collection of tickets bought online. Assistance is not far away, with help points available on-site, and customer information provided through departure screens and announcements.

Accessibility at Hanborough makes travel straightforward for everyone. The station is a Step Free Category A, offering level access throughout, and equ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ops. However, there aren't accessible toilets or waiting rooms here, so plan accordingly for comfort during wait times. You’ll find CCTV for added security throughout the premises.

Parking and Transport Links

Driving to Hanborough station is made simple with its well-managed car park operated by APCOA Parking, providing 48 spaces including two designated for accessible parking. Parking is available 24/7 with reasonable day charges and options for longer-term passes.

For those looking to extend their journey via other modes of transport, Hanborough is well linked. Information for local bus services and connecting rail replacement services is available. For those catching flights, transfer at Reading for Heathrow or Gatwick, or Bristol Temple Meads for connections to Bristol Airport.
